Design Tips
Before we jump into specific bathroom design ideas, here are a few general tips. Natural light is key in coastal design, so maximize window space and consider adding mirrors to reflect light. Embrace natural textures like wood, wicker, and stone. Keep the color palette light and airy, incorporating shades of blue, green, white, and beige. Finally, don’t be afraid to incorporate nautical accents, but avoid going overboard – a few well-chosen pieces will create the desired effect without feeling kitschy.
18 Design Ideas
Driftwood Accent Wall: Reclaimed driftwood planks create a stunning focal point, adding warmth and texture. The natural, weathered look brings the essence of the beach right into your bathroom.

Seaglass Tile Backsplash: Iridescent seaglass tiles create a shimmering, ocean-inspired backsplash. Their subtle color variations add depth and visual interest, catching the light beautifully.

Nautical Rope Mirror: Frame a simple mirror with nautical rope for a charming, DIY touch. This adds a playful, maritime element without being overwhelming.

Shell-Embedded Countertops: Incorporate crushed shells into your countertop material for a unique and luxurious feel. This subtle detail adds a touch of seaside glamour.

Ocean-Inspired Artwork: Hang framed prints or canvases depicting seascapes, marine life, or coastal landscapes. This adds a personalized touch and reinforces the coastal theme.

Wicker Baskets for Storage: Use wicker baskets for stylish and practical storage solutions. They add texture and warmth while keeping clutter at bay.

Whitewashed Shiplap Walls: Create a classic coastal look with whitewashed shiplap walls. This adds texture and dimension while keeping the space bright and airy.

Blue and White Striped Towels: Add a pop of color with blue and white striped towels. This classic nautical pattern instantly evokes a seaside vibe.

Pebble Shower Floor: Create a spa-like experience with a pebble shower floor. The smooth stones provide a gentle massage for your feet and add a natural element.

Glass Jar Soap Dispensers: Opt for clear glass jar soap dispensers filled with seashells or sand. This adds a touch of coastal charm to your vanity.

Coastal-Scented Candles: Fill the air with the refreshing scents of the ocean with coastal-scented candles. Choose fragrances like sea salt, driftwood, or ocean breeze.

Rattan Light Fixtures: Add warmth and texture with rattan light fixtures. These natural woven pendants create a relaxed and inviting atmosphere.

Aquamarine Accent Tiles: Incorporate aquamarine accent tiles into your shower or backsplash. This vibrant hue evokes the color of the ocean.

Seashell Decor Accents: Scatter seashells and starfish tastefully throughout the bathroom. These natural elements bring the beach indoors.

Light Blue Walls: Paint the walls a calming shade of light blue to mimic the sky and sea. This creates a serene and airy backdrop for your coastal decor.

Woven Rug: Add a soft, textured woven rug in natural fibers like jute or sisal. This adds warmth and comfort underfoot.

Vintage Nautical Maps: Frame vintage nautical maps and hang them on the walls for a touch of history and adventure. This adds a unique and personalized touch.

Open Shelving with Coastal Decor: Install open shelving and display coastal-themed decor items like coral, sea glass, and pottery. This creates a visually appealing display and adds personality.

FAQs
1. What colors are best for a coastal bathroom? Light and airy colors like white, beige, blue, green, and gray are ideal for creating a coastal feel.
2. How can I incorporate natural elements into my coastal bathroom? Use materials like wood, stone, wicker, and seashells to bring the outdoors in.
3. What are some good lighting options for a coastal bathroom? Natural light is key, so maximize window space. Consider adding sconces, pendants, or a statement chandelier for a touch of elegance.
4. How can I add storage to my coastal bathroom? Use wicker baskets, open shelving, or vanity cabinets to keep your bathroom organized.
5. What are some easy ways to update my bathroom with a coastal theme? Switch out your towels, shower curtain, and bath mat for coastal-inspired options. Add a few decorative accents like seashells or coral.
6. Can I achieve a coastal look in a small bathroom? Absolutely! Light colors, mirrors, and strategic storage solutions can make a small bathroom feel larger and brighter.
7. What are some good flooring options for a coastal bathroom? Tile, stone, and vinyl plank flooring are all great options for a coastal bathroom. Consider a pebble shower floor for a spa-like touch.
